Fan games are often more feature-rich than the originals, including modern graphics and updated mechanics. Pokémon Indigo (Añil)

: This is widely considered the best modern remake of the Indigo League. It features a choice between "Classic" and "Complete" modes (the latter including Mega Evolutions and later-gen Pokémon), plus an expanded Kanto map.

How to play: Since it’s an RPG Maker game, you need the JoiPlay emulator (available on Google Play) to run it on Android. Pokémon Ash Gray

: A famous ROM hack that follows the exact plot of the Indigo League anime. You start with Pikachu, deal with Spearow swarms, and follow Ash's specific journey. Pokémon FireRed Rocket Edition

: A unique twist where you play as a Team Rocket Grunt during the Indigo League events, stealing Pokémon and uncovering the "truth" behind the Kanto region. 3. Reliable Download Sources

Many veterans consider Pokémon Yellow Special Pikachu Edition the truest Indigo League game because it was designed specifically to mimic the anime.

How to Play: You can download various Game Boy Color emulators (such as My OldBoy!) from Google Play.

Gameplay: Start with Pikachu, face off against Jessie and James, and follow the exact path Ash took to the Indigo Plateau. 4. Other Notable Fan Projects
